GRAB trades at $3.66, down 0.27% on the day, with a bullish technical signal and strong earnings beats in recent quarters. Revenue grew to $3.37B in 2025, with net income turning positive at $268M, reflecting improved profitability. The company raised its 2026 guidance, supported by growth in on-demand and financial services segments. Analyst sentiment is overwhelmingly positive, with 91.67% recommending Buy.
Outlook remains favorable due to sustained revenue growth and margin expansion, but risks include high valuation multiples and insider selling. The stock offers upside to the average price target of $5.86, though volatility from competitive pressures and macroeconomic headwinds warrants caution.

FLRN invests in U.S. dollar-denominated investment-grade floating rate notes with maturities under five years. It provides exposure to corporate and supranational debt whose interest payments adjust with market rates, helping to mitigate interest rate risk.
